Photography, The Amateur Photographer, a large uniface square bronze award plaque, unsigned, camera above globe, back named (W. Aylward), 82mm; The Practical Photographer, a bronze award plaque by Bladon, London, standing robed female preparing to squeeze shutter mechanism of camera on tripod, flowering plant at right, rev. named (W.H. Nithsdale), 53 x 33mm [2]. About extremely fine (£40-60)
